Output 521d3615087fe2d14db9b9819b10c3bbf2aafa62c1a9a788f2e6b1d4545b6a53:0

value
110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668b321e49637ebf6cc215c526152360f5fed20a OP_EQUAL
address
3B3DbbtqCFswVqeqUygovMtqy9xZZo6mGX
transaction
521d3615087fe2d14db9b9819b10c3bbf2aafa62c1a9a788f2e6b1d4545b6a53
spent
true